1. Fulfill your need for vitamin D

Vitamin D deficiency may be a cause of chronic pain. Fish and morning sun is the largest source for this vitamin. The average person needs about 200 IU of vitamin D per day, but for those aged 50 to 70 years increases the need for vitamin D to 400 IU per day. For those who have stepped over age 70, needs vitamin D to 500 IU.

A study at the University of Minnesota found that 93 percent of the total respondents who experience non-specific musculoskeletal pain, suffering from lack of vitamin D. Giving vitamin D supplements to patients can relieve muscle pain arises. The study investigators also concluded that those who have non-specific musculoskeletal pain, continually, to undergo screening for vitamin D deficiency

2. Inhaling aroma of green apples

Research conducted by the Smell & Taste Treatment and Research Foundation in Chicago, USA, instructs participants - who at the same time was migraine pain - to sniff the smell test tube containing a green apple. The results showed that the condition of those who inhale the smell of green apples is improved compared with those who do not inhale the smell of green apples. The researchers assume, given by the aroma of green apple is able to offset the muscle contractions that occur in the head and neck, thus providing a sense of relief in the head. In a previous study, the smell of green apples also been found to fight anxiety.

3. Meditating

The effectiveness of meditation in relieving pain without the side effects have been revealed in several studies. The experts in this field believe, meditated for approximately one hour can help relieve pain. The study also showed that meditation can increase brain activity in areas such as the anterior cingulate cortex, anterior insula and orbito-frontal cortex. Three regions of the brain is in charge of mapping the various forms of pain received by the brain from nerve signals to various parts of the body.

4. Balneotherapy

Balneotherapy is not something strange because of the way it has been practiced since ancient times. The term "balneo" comes from the Latin word "Balneum" meaning bath. Balneotherapy is a kind of hydrotherapy, where the treatment is done by using a bath of mineral water or warm water. Mineral water, which is used form of magnesium sulfate or Epsom salts, capable of flexing muscles. Both magnesium and sulfate is a mineral that is easily absorbed by the skin, and studies have shown that the amount of magnesium in the body will increase after a shower using plenty of water containing Epsom salt. In addition, balneotherapy can also increase blood circulation and relieve inflammation.

7. Breathing techniques

Relaxation by drawing deep breaths can help relieve headaches, back pain, joint pain, and pain caused by cancer yagn. Breathing techniques can be used to relieve pain in the body so that the mind can be reduced, this can happen by considering the relationship between mind and body. This technique is capable of incorporating elements such as body awareness, breathing, movement and meditation in a single stream. Even more exciting, in addition to easy and can be done anywhere, this therapy does not cost a thing.

The trick, breathe for a count of four, try to fill your lungs with air from the bottom to the top by pushing your stomach, then followed until it reaches the bottom of the rib cage and finally make sure your chest full of witchcraft air, hold for three seconds, then exhale. Breathing can distract you from the pain.
